Make a bold architectural statement in your space with the Euphorbia Trigona, commonly known as the African Milk Tree or Cathedral Cactus. Featuring striking three-sided upright stems lined with sharp spines and tiny tear-drop leaves, this structural succulent gives you all the desert cactus aesthetic with much faster growth. Perfect for modern interiors, bright rooms, and busy plant parents.

Plant Care Guide

  • ☀️ Light: Place in bright, indirect light or full sunlight. Gets vibrant green color and fuller leaves with more light.

  • 💧 Water: Allow the soil to dry out completely between waterings. Water sparingly during winter months.

  • 🪴 Soil: Requires well-draining succulent or cactus potting mix.

  • 🌡️ Temperature: Thrives in warm environments (65°F–85°F / 18°C–29°C). Protect from frost.
